Why doesn't Paparonni's offer delivery?
|
First, there's no such thing as "free delivery". Someone has to pay for the expense of delivery (labor, insurance) and ultimately it is the customer, by accepting inferior quality (not to mention tips)! We only use superior ingredients and more of them and have found that our satisfied customers overwhelmingly prefer a quality pizza fresh from the oven rather than a "delivery" pizza that's been kept in a warmer for 30-45 minutes while a driver searches for your house. |

Why aren't you open late like many pizza restaurants? |
Our hours of operation reflect the market we serve. We've found that we are able to accommodate the majority of our customers while avoiding the costs/risks of being open after 9-10 pm. Additionally, this allows us to utilize young adults in the operation.

Does Paparonni's ever have "two for one" specials? |
Just as there are no "free lunches", there are no free pizzas. We believe in fair and reasonable pricing coupled with weekday specials and quantity discounts. While competitors may "shock" you with their regular prices in order to steer you toward their "special offers", we would rather provide quality pizza at a fair price and leave the games and gimmicks to the other guys. The problem with discount pizza is that it usually tastes like discount pizza. |
